What is E211?

Sodium benzoate, also known as benzoate of soda, is the sodium salt of benzoic acid, widely used as a food preservative and a pickling agent. It appears as a white crystalline chemical with the formula C6H5COONa. E211 sits in the E200–E299 series, which in the EU classification mainly covers preservatives.

Is E211 safe?

E211 is one of the additives Skaren flags as “avoid”. Avoid combining with Vitamin C (E300). Many people choose to limit their intake of it. “Avoid” means it is linked to health concerns, requires a warning label, or is banned in some countries.

Regulatory status. EFSA has set an Acceptable Daily Intake (ADI) of 5 mg per kg body weight per day for E211. EFSA has noted a possible risk of overexposure (high) for some population groups.

How E211 appears on labels

On food packaging you'll find E211 either as the number “E211” or by the name “Sodium benzoate” in the ingredient list, often after its function. Ingredients are listed in descending order by weight, so an additive near the end is present only in small amounts.
